MintBucks are Alignmint's universal credit system for marketing. Think of them like stamps — each marketing action costs a certain number of credits. Email, SMS, postcards, letters, and handwritten cards all use the same simple credit system.

Smart Credit Usage

The system always uses your free monthly credits first before dipping into purchased ones. So your purchased MintBucks are only used when you exceed your monthly allowance.

No Expiration

Unlike monthly credits that reset on the 1st, purchased MintBucks never expire. Buy in bulk for big campaigns and use them whenever you need them.
